Hotel Jen Launches Plastic Free Awareness Campaign

Hotel Jen Maldives has initiated an awareness campaign on "Plastic Bag-Free Day," highlighting the need to reduce the use of plastic bags and promoting more use of recycled paper bags. 


"The Say no to plastic bag July campaign at hotel Jen Male Maldives will be one of our initiative to moving away from single-use plastics, by joining the global fight against plastic in conjunction with the world no plastic campaign month." Reads a statement by the Hotel. 


"The Jen Mega Bag will be kept at the hotel lobby throughout the month of July and with pledge notes for guests who are visiting to take a photo or selfie and create awareness on this by using the hashtags #Plasticfreejuly #HotelJenMaleMaldives #TheJenBag #WorldNoPlasticDay #ChoosetoRefuse #CleanGreenerMaleCity."


The staffs of the Hotel who work in different departments gathered up at the all-day dining restaurant Lime, where the event took place after the General Manager Rahim Flynn address the colleagues on the importance of using recycled and environment friendly bags, the pledge was taken by all the colleagues where they pinned the Jen Mega bag with recycled paper bags of Jen.


The participants were given further information on the topic by Rhoda Maceda Director of Human Resources and CSR Champion of Hotel Jen Maldives. 


Hotel Jen recently also started the plastic recycle campaign in collaboration with Beam, a Non-Government Organisation (NGO) focusing on Biodiversity Education & Awareness in Maldives and Parley is the international environmental protection organisation for the Oceans. 




Together with Parley, Beam focus is to reduce and Intercept the waste that will end up in oceans in the Maldives. It empowers the island communities and organisations in protecting the environment through awareness sessions, clean-up campaign and plastic waste collection and segregation. 


Plastic bags can take hundreds of years to degrade, releasing tiny particles of toxic chemicals into soil and water,  polluting the environment and harming many living organisms, such as those in marine environments. 


Hotel Jen collected a total of 367 kg of plastic from April to December last year and up to 235.7 kgs of plastic Since the beginning of this year and sent to Beam Parley. The Hotel states that their target is to collect more plastic than last year and also has held several awareness sessions to enhance the importance of minimising and recycling the plastic in their daily lives.
